Exploring File Paths in Linux

Navigating within the Linux ecosystem requires an understanding of file paths, these digital pathways that lead to files and directories scattered throughout the system’s architecture. Users interact with the operating system, a family of open-source systems, through a Terminal, a console that, in symbiosis with the Shell, allows navigation through the complex layers of the system. The distinction between the absolute path, which always starts with the root ‘/’, and the relative path, which refers to the current location, is fundamental for effective command line usage.

In this interaction, the command ‘pushd in Linux’ becomes an advanced navigation tool. It allows switching between directories without losing track of your work. Imagine a stack of folders on a desk; with pushd, you add folders to the stack and with ‘popd’, you remove them, thus returning to your starting point. It’s an organized and quick way to navigate the system without losing sight of the path taken.

Mastering Advanced Commands for File and Directory Management

Navigating the heart of the Linux operating system requires familiarity with a set of Linux commands dedicated to file and directory management. These programs or utilities, executed on the command line, constitute the very essence of Linux’s power and flexibility. The seasoned user, often wielding the privileges of the root user, handles these commands with surgical precision, modifying permissions, moving data, and sculpting the environment to their needs. Understanding file permissions for reading, writing, and executing, and adjusting them via the ‘chmod‘ command are fundamental skills for securing and managing access to data.

Beyond managing rights, the ability to create ‘aliases‘ to simplify frequently used commands or the use of shortcuts like ‘ctrl‘ to interrupt a running process enriches the user’s work environment. Displaying file options and consulting file content are also key functions enabled by advanced commands in Linux. Commands like ‘ls’ with its multiple options or ‘cat’ to display the content of a file are daily tools for the expert. Displaying detailed information about files or directories becomes a routine operation, but essential for system monitoring and maintenance.

It should be noted that Linux commands are case-sensitive, making their handling precise and sometimes tricky for newcomers. This illustrates the meticulous nature of working under Linux, where every character matters.
